Africa-Press – Nigeria. More than 80 countries have failed in their quest to secure qualification for the 2026 FIFA World Cup.

This comes following the conclusion of the September World Cup qualifiers played across the globe.

In the Africa zone, about 18 nations have failed in their quest to secure next year’s World Cup ticket after recording the lowest points in their different groups.

The countries are Congo, Chad, Djibouti, Ethiopia, Eswatini, Zimbabwe, Kenya, Lesotho, Mauritania, Mauritius, São Tomé and Príncipe, Seychelles, Somalia, South Sudan, The Gambia, Togo, Burundi and Central African Republic

Here are the nations that have been eliminated from the 2026 World Cup qualifiers globally after the September round of qualifiers:

Togo, Tajikistan, Thailand, Gambia, Timor-Leste, Tonga, Turkmenistan, Turks and Caicos Islands, US Virgin Islands, Vanuatu, Vietnam, Yemen, Zimbabwe, Afghanistan, American Samoa, Philippines, Puerto Rico, Samoa, São Tomé and Príncipe, Seychelles, Somalia, Singapore, Solomon Islands, South Sudan, Sri Lanka, St. Kitts and Nevis, St. Lucia, St. Vincent and the Grenadines, Syria and Tahiti.

Others include Anguilla, Antigua and Barbuda, Aruba, Bahamas, Bahrain, Bangladesh, Barbados, Belize, Bhutan, British Virgin Islands, Brunei, Burundi, Cambodia, Cayman Islands, Central African Republic, Chad, Chile, China PR, Chinese Taipei, Congo, Cook Islands, Cuba, Djibouti, Dominica, Dominican Republic and Ethiopia.

The remaining are Eswatini, Fiji, Gibraltar, Grenada, Guam, Guyana, Hong Kong, China, India, Kenya, Korea DPR, Kuwait, Kyrgyz Republic, Laos, Lebanon, Lesotho, Liechtenstein, Macau, Malaysia, Maldives, Mauritania, Mauritius, Papua New Guinea, Mongolia, Montserrat, Myanmar, Nepal, Pakistan, Peru and Palestine.
